Drivers must concentrate
I agree that a 90kph speed limit on narrow country roads is too high but an 80kph limit on major roads is too low.
Excessive speed is a contributory factor in causing accidents but I believe the majority are due to a lack of concentration, including the use of mobile devices at the wheel, and drivers performing dangerous and reckless manoeuvres.
